I&#8217;m wondering if we can open a conversation on what works best?<\/p>\n<p>trying to be,<\/p>\n<p>an informed parent<\/p><\/blockquote>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\">Today&#8217;s availability\u00a0of technology and communication methods (e.g., newsletter, note, phone, email, website, twitter, apps, etc.) invite us to\u00a0reconsider how we\u00a0share information with families. Asking <em>What communication strategy works best?<\/em> or <em>How can we best reach you?<\/em> demonstrates respect for families and opens a necessary conversation about communication that\u00a0can form the foundation for dialogue about families&#8217;\u00a0hopes, dreams, successes, and struggles.<\/p>\n<ul style=\"text-align: justify\">\n<li>How do you share information\u00a0with families? Do you use a variety of strategies including\u00a0paper, telephone, email, oral transmission from child to family?<\/li>\n<li>Do your communication strategies respond to the strengths and preferences\u00a0identified by families?<\/li>\n<li>In your communication and information sharing, are you using language that is both friendly and easily understood, and not loaded with\u00a0edu-speak?<\/li>\n<li>Do\u00a0you\u00a0provide translators\/translations if necessary?\u00a0Do you incorporate oral and visual forms of communication in addition to traditional print?<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\">Effective communication and\u00a0information sharing strategies\u00a0recognize that just\u00a0because the school has sent home a message in one way\u00a0does not mean that every family got it. The good news is that the harder we try, and the more we diversify our communication,\u00a0\u00a0the more likely the message is to be received. This is not to suggest that every family needs a completely different strategy, but instead that it is necessary to find an\u00a0effective\u00a0balance that meets the needs of both family and school.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\">Some families\u00a0prefer the face-to-face interaction that comes with picking their child up at school, others\u00a0appreciate a\u00a0quick phone call home. Some\u00a0prefer a quick note in a child&#8217;s agenda, while others are easily reachable by email. And then there are those who eagerly check the school\/classroom blog\/website; these families will tell you that it&#8217;s even better if automatic updates are generated and sent directly to their\u00a0inbox. The trick is in anticipating the multitude of strategies that might meet the ever-increasing demands placed on today&#8217;s families.\u00a0As you envision your communication plan,\u00a0make sure to\u00a0check your school and district policies\u00a0regarding email, website, and other forms of social communication.\u00a0Schools might consider the following:<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><strong>Invite \u00a0families to identify\u00a0their\u00a0preferred\u00a0communication strategies.<\/strong>\u00a0Send a quick survey home to families that enables them to discuss and select the most effective way to communicate or share information. Try to match the communication strategies\u00a0of the school\/class with those preferred by families. Realize that there are times when communication strategies vary with the day-to-day life of a family.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><strong>Involve<\/strong><strong> children and youth in oral\u00a0information sharing strategies.<\/strong><strong>\u00a0<\/strong>Schedule assemblies or discussions that highlight the importance of some messages and assign\u00a0students the first level of contact with families. You&#8217;d be surprised how much information really does make it home\u2026 it might be a little bit like a game of telephone, but a quick follow up by email or a note in the agenda serves as important clarification.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><strong>Engage\u00a0children and youth in the construction and maintenance\u00a0of a traditional class newsletter that could easily be posted to a website or blog.<\/strong>\u00a0Post student work and summaries alongside\u00a0important information; this keeps families aware\u00a0of the day-to-day life in the classroom as well as keeping them informed. Recognize the necessary balance of showing and telling in order to accommodate those families whose linguistic needs do not fall into mainstream English. Offer a multiple access option (digital or paper) recognizing that not all\u00a0families have access to computers or other digital means.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><strong>Explore communication strategies that blend the old and the\u00a0new technologies for both school and class\u00a0messages<\/strong>. For example,<\/p>\n<ul style=\"text-align: justify\">\n<li><a href=\"http:\/\/www.synrevoice.com\/?page_id=1864\">Synrevoice School Connects<\/a>\u00a0enables schools\u00a0to send \u00a0phone calls, email, and SMS text messages to families, regarding any kind of school related event.<img decoding=\"async\" title=\"More...\" src=\"https:\/\/www.synrevoice.com\/wp-includes\/js\/tinymce\/plugins\/wordpress\/img\/trans.gif\" alt=\"\" \/><\/li>\n<li><a href=\"https:\/\/www.remind.com\">Remind<\/a>\u00a0 is a free service that lets teachers\u00a0send one-way messages via SMS or email to everyone involved with the class.
